Barugh Green Road is in Barugh Green, Barnsley and in Barnsley district. S75 1JT is located in the Darton West elect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Barnsley Central.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

People

Gender

In the UK, the overall gender distribution is approximately 49% male and 51% female. However, the area surrounding S75 1JT, has a female population slightly higher than UK average, with 53.2% of residents being female. Several factors can contribute to this. Women generally live longer than men, resulting in a higher proportion of women in neighborhoods with significant elderly populations. Typically, as people grow older, they tend to relocate from city center addresses to suburban areas, smaller towns, and rural locations. Consequently, these areas often have a higher number of females. A higher female population can also be found in areas with industries that employ more women, such as healthcare, education, and retail.

Safety

Is Barugh Green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Barugh Green Road was 36.4 per 1,000 residents, which is 35.8% lower than the Darton East average. The most reported crime type was Anti-social behaviour.

Barugh Green Road has the 31st lowest crime rate of 92 local areas in Darton East and the 157th lowest crime rate of 841 local areas in Barnsley .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 12.1 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has risen by about 3.3%.

Employment

S75 1JT area has a low unemployment rate. According to Census 2021, 3% residents of this area were unemployed, while the average in the UK was 4.83%. A low level of unemployment in an area indicates a strong job market, where most people who are seeking work can find employment. This generally reflects a healthy economy in the area.

The percentage of retired residents living in S75 1JT area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 32%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
